    It is important to Note before starting the solution that the Highest activity level is above 17,500 units which would mean that total costs at this activity level includes step up of fixed costs of $5,000. I proceeded to work the solution without taking this into consideration and did not get any of the answers given, so I chose the answer which was closest to the given choices, which was wrong. After reviewing the solution I still could not see why I could not figure this out, then I realized that the highest activity is over 17,500. Hope this helps my fellow students.

    hi. there’s something i’m unable to understand. question 3.
    it seems that another method is being used here..and mine is actually wrong.
    why the answer is not so?

    135000-110000/25000-20000 which equals to 5 (variable cost).
    the next step for me is : 135000-(5*25000)=10000.(fixed cost)
    and therefore, total cost=135000+(10000*5)=185000

    logically, i know that the total costs for 22000 units should be lower than that of the 25000 units which is $135000. but i cant fathom where is the mistake.

    please explain. 馃檨

    Log in to Reply
    • John Moffat says

      August 24, 2016 at 3:46 pm

      Since the variable cost is $5 per unit, the total variable cost of 22,000 units is $110,000
      The fixed cost is $10,000
      Therefore the total cost is $120,000
